fight off
English
Verb
fight
off
(
see inflection at
fight
)
To succeed in
defeating
a challenge, or an attack.
The platoon
fought off
the guerilla attack.
The actor John Smith hopes to
fight off
the other nominees for the Golden Globe award.
To
resist
, particularly an infection or an emotion.
I'm
fighting off
the 'flu at the moment.
